package main
import (
"os"
"golang.org/x/crypto/ssh/terminal"
"fmt"
"strings"
"unicode/utf8"
)
type Screen interface {
Draw(i *ClipboardItem) error
}
type TerminalScreen struct {
TerminalWidth int
}
func NewTerminalScreen() (*TerminalScreen, error) {
s := &TerminalScreen{}
s.TerminalWidth = s.getWindowWidth()
s.init()
return s, nil
}
func (s *TerminalScreen) init() {
sideLength := (s.TerminalWidth - len(AppName)) / 2
fmt.Printf("%s%s%s\n", strings.Repeat("=", sideLength), "Goppy", strings.Repeat("=", sideLength))
}
func (s *TerminalScreen) Draw(i *ClipboardItem) error {
if ! utf8.Valid(i.Contents) {
fmt.Printf("<Cannot display binary data>\n")
} else {
fmt.Printf("%s\n", i.Contents)
}
fmt.Printf("%s\n", strings.Repeat("=", s.TerminalWidth))
return nil
}
func (s *TerminalScreen) getWindowWidth() int {
w, _, err := terminal.GetSize(int(os.Stdin.Fd()))
if err != nil {
w = 0
}
return MaxInt(w, HeaderLength)
}
type NoScreen struct {}
func (NoScreen) Draw(i *ClipboardItem) error {
// Pass
return nil
}
func truncateString(s string, maxLen, maxLines int) string {
originalLength := len(s)
splitLines := strings.Split(s, "\n")[:maxLines]
s = strings.Join(splitLines, "\n")
maxLen = maxAcceptableLength(s, maxLen)
// Nothing was truncated
if len(s) == originalLength {
return s
}
return s[:maxLen] + TruncatedSuffix
}
func maxAcceptableLength(s string, maxLen int) int {
if len(s) > maxLen {
return maxLen
}
return len(s)
}
